The CLEVELAND C91713 is a solid pilot counterbore designed for precision counterboring of socket-head cap screw seat recesses in metalworking applications. Built from high-speed steel (HSS) with a bright, uncoated finish, it features a 37/64-inch counterbore diameter, a 25/64-inch standard pilot diameter, and three flutes for efficient chip evacuation. The 1/2-inch straight-cylindrical shank provides secure chuck engagement, and the 6.5-inch overall length accommodates a range of workpiece setups. Machinists and tool-and-die technicians use this counterbore with manual or CNC drilling equipment to produce clean, flat-bottomed recesses that seat socket-head cap screws flush or below the workpiece surface.
The C91713 is suited for use on alloy tool steel, carbon steel, and cast iron workpieces. The 3/8-inch fastener size compatibility makes it a direct-fit tool for preparing recesses that accept standard 3/8-inch socket-head cap screws. It is appropriate for production machining, maintenance-repair-overhaul (MRO) shops, and fabrication environments where consistent counterbore geometry and screw-seat concentricity are required. The standard pilot design ensures the counterbore tracks the existing through-hole accurately without requiring a separate piloting step.

This tool is installed and operated by machinists using drill presses, milling machines, or CNC machining centers. Secure the shank firmly in the chuck or collet before operation and verify the pilot fits the existing through-hole without excessive play. Run at speeds and feeds appropriate for HSS tooling in the specific workpiece material, and apply cutting fluid when machining steel to extend tool life. Inspect the pilot and cutting edges for wear before each use.
